The House of Life
Dick and Barb Hammond never thought their lives would lead them to work in Haiti for over thirty years, especially after what they saw the first time they arrived in the country. But, despite the many challenges of working in a place where change is slow, this truly special couple overcame great obstacles in the pursuit of bringing health care and hope to the Haitian people. The House of Life is not only the story of how the Hammonds came to build a clinic in Haiti, but the story of the beauty and resilience of a country and its people, the power of persistence, and the uniqueness of one couple s decision to take on such a large project later in life.
